Nicotinamide Riboside vs NMN: Which NAD+ Precursor Should You Take?
If you have shopped for an NAD+ supplement, you have seen two acronyms: NR (nicotinamide riboside) and NMN (nicotinamide mononucleotide). Both are vitamin B3 derivatives, both end up as NAD+ inside the cell, and both have human data. They are not interchangeable.
How they differ chemically
NMN is NR with a phosphate group attached. Because of that phosphate, NMN is larger and charged, and most evidence suggests it has to be converted to NR (or transported by a specialized carrier) before it enters cells. NR is one step closer to the cell and is taken up directly, then converted to NMN and finally NAD+ by the NRK enzymes.
Human evidence
NR has the larger body of controlled human trials. Trammell 2016 (single-dose pharmacokinetics), Martens 2018 (six weeks, ~60% increase in blood NAD+), Dollerup 2018 (12 weeks, 2,000mg/day in obese men, well tolerated), Elhassan 2019 (skeletal-muscle NAD+ metabolome in older adults) and Conze 2019 (an eight-week safety study at up to 1,000mg/day) all used NR.
NMN has a smaller but growing set: Yoshino 2021 reported improved muscle insulin sensitivity in prediabetic women after 10 weeks at 250mg/day; Yi 2023 found dose-dependent NAD+ increases at 300–900mg/day over 60 days.
Regulatory status
NR has GRAS (Generally Recognized as Safe) status in the US and a New Dietary Ingredient notification on file with the FDA. NMN's status has been contested: in late 2022 the FDA stated NMN was excluded from the dietary-supplement definition because it had been investigated as a drug, and its availability has fluctuated since. Dose and cost
Most human NR studies used 250–1,000mg per day. Most NMN studies used 250–900mg. The transporter debate
For years the textbook view was that NMN had to lose its phosphate to become NR before entering a cell. In 2019, Grozio et al. (Nature Metabolism) reported that the protein Slc12a8 acts as a dedicated NMN transporter in the mouse small intestine. The finding was immediately contested — Schmidt and Brenner published a critique in the same journal questioning the methodology — and the question is still open. What is not in doubt: NR is taken up by cells directly via nucleoside transporters and converted by the NRK enzymes, a route that has been characterised since Bieganowski and Brenner described the NRK pathway in Cell in 2004. Stability and handling
Both molecules are hygroscopic and both degrade with heat and moisture. NR is usually stabilised as a salt — nicotinamide riboside chloride or, in simplyNAD+, nicotinamide riboside hydrogen malate — and sealed away from air. What the trials reported on side effects
In the eight-week Conze et al. (2019) safety study, adults took 100, 300 or 1,000mg of NR per day; adverse events were mild and their frequency was similar to placebo. Dollerup et al. (2018) reported that 2,000mg per day for 12 weeks was well tolerated in overweight men. Unlike niacin (nicotinic acid), NR does not cause the characteristic skin flush. NMN trials at 250–900mg per day (Yoshino 2021; Yi 2023) also reported good tolerability. Neither molecule has a long-term outcome trial yet — the longest human data for either is measured in months.
Can you take both?
There is no established reason to. NR becomes NMN inside the cell, so stacking the two means paying twice for one pathway. Frequently asked
Is NMN banned in the US? Its status as a dietary ingredient has been contested by the FDA since late 2022 and has shifted more than once since; check current FDA guidance before relying on it. NR's status has not been challenged.
Does one absorb faster? Both reach the bloodstream within an hour or two in human pharmacokinetic studies. Speed of absorption is not the deciding factor — daily consistency is.
